    Overview

  • Dr. Soumya B M is an experienced medical oncologist in Bengaluru with specialised training in the management of solid and haematological malignancies. She is currently practising as a Specialist – Medical Oncology at Manipal Clinic Indiranagar, bringing focused expertise in systemic cancer therapies, precision oncology, and multidisciplinary cancer care. Dr. Soumya completed her MBBS from Karnataka Medical College and Research Centre, Hubballi, followed by an MD in General Medicine from Government Medical College and Hospital, Aurangabad. She further pursued DrNB Medical Oncology at Manipal Hospitals, Bengaluru, where she underwent structured superspecialty training in cancer medicine.

  • Her clinical practice includes the management of a wide range of malignancies affecting different organ systems. She is trained in administering systemic cancer therapies such as chemotherapy, immunotherapy, targeted therapy, and hormonal therapy. These treatments are tailored to the biological behaviour of individual tumours and patient-specific clinical factors. Her experience includes treatment planning, dose modifications based on tolerance, and careful monitoring of treatment-related toxicities to ensure safe and effective cancer care.

  • Dr. Soumya’s expertise also includes the interpretation of pathology findings, molecular markers, and next-generation sequencing (NGS) reports that guide precision oncology strategies. By integrating molecular diagnostics into clinical decision-making, treatment approaches can be tailored to the genetic profile of tumours, improving therapeutic response and patient outcomes.
